James Guo <jinp65@yahoo.com> writes:
> Have a tv tuner believe to be sinovideo 1300, and the remote has h-338 in the
> back, the tuner is detected as saa7134 proteus 2309, and working fine, the
> patch is for the remote.
>
> following buttons supposed to be working: all the number button, channel up and
> down, volumn up and down, off, mute, full screen, recall, snapshot, tv. Some
> buttons do not have valid entry for tvtime, so I did not map them(record, stop
> ...)
>
> to apply, use command
> modprobe saa7134 card=157
> if it does not work, use
> modprobe saa7134 card=157 ir_debug=1
> and send me the output of dmesg(after modprobe and after a button is pressed)
I think we should add something printing changes on the GPIO line (and
current time). That should be easy, will try to have something soon.
That would show what code exactly a remote is using, at last.
